The California Youth Authority is responsible for the protection of society from the criminal and delinquent behavior of young people. Students are escorted to the Trade Line from their living areas by "Youth Correctional Counselors" (YCC). In a reorganization of the California corrections agencies, the CYA became the Division of Juvenile Justice (DJJ) within CDCR in 2005. During lockdowns, wards are allowed showers three times a week, but are allowed no time to attend school, exercise or interact with mental health professionals. In January 2002, a federal conditions lawsuit was filed against CYA by a coalition including the Prison Law Office. Approximately Karl Holton served as the first director of the CYA.
